在Click + Zend Framework上加载数据库中的数据

时间:2013-01-22 17:19:28

标签: javascript database zend-framework

我想在点击链接时从数据库加载数据。 我的链接是来自数据库的数据。这就是我在我看来这样做的方式:

<div id="wijken">
              <ul>
            <?php foreach($this->districts as $districts) : ?>
              <li><a><?php echo $this->escape($districts->wijk); ?></a></li>       
            <?php endforeach; ?>
              </ul>
          </div>

它的外观如下: enter image description here

现在我希望您点击一个链接,我可以根据您点击的链接加载数据并显示数据库中的数据。我怎么能这样做?

我用javascript试了一下。是否可以使用ajax调用来加载控制器中的操作数据?

我的javascript:

$("#wijken ul li a").click(function(e){  

var wijk = ($(this).text());

$.ajax({ 

  type: "POST",
  url: "index/test",                    
  data: "wijk",                        

  dataType: 'json',                
  success: function(rows)          
  {
      alert("worked!");

  }, 
  error: function(error){
      alert("didn't worked!");
  }

  });

这可行吗?

1 个答案:

答案 0 :(得分:2)

这个答案可以帮到你

https://stackoverflow.com/a/8489447/949273

这是使用Zend Framework和Ajax(JQuery)的一个简单示例。